Panel Effectiveness Scores



As you discover the world of solar panels, understanding panel efficiency rankings is crucial for making an informed choice. These ratings indicate how properly a panel transforms sunshine into usable electricity. The higher the efficiency, the extra energy you'll produce from a smaller room. Many household panels vary from 15% to 22% efficiency.

When selecting your panels, consider your power demands and available roofing system area. If you have actually restricted space, going with higher-efficiency panels could be valuable. Nevertheless, if you have adequate roof area, lower-efficiency panels could be adequate.

Installment Kind Choices



Picking the appropriate installation kind for solar panels can dramatically influence your system's performance and performance. You'll generally encounter two main alternatives: roof-mounted and ground-mounted systems.

Roof-mounted panels are often the go-to selection for home owners, as they make use of existing room and can be more economical to install. Nevertheless, if your roofing isn't ideal-- possibly due to shielding or architectural concerns-- ground-mounted systems might be the much better alternative.

They permit optimal positioning, optimizing sunlight exposure. Additionally, you can adjust their angle to improve efficiency.

Before deciding, take into consideration variables like available space, budget, and regional guidelines. By reviewing these alternatives thoroughly, you'll guarantee your solar panel installment fulfills your power needs successfully.

Visual Considerations



While performance is essential, aesthetics shouldn't be overlooked when choosing solar panels for your home. You desire panels that not only job successfully however additionally enhance your home's style.

Think about the color and dimension of the solar panels; black panels often blend seamlessly with dark roofs, while blue panels could stick out more. Check out alternatives like building-integrated photovoltaics (BIPV) that change conventional roof products, using a streamlined appearance.

You can also discover solar roof shingles, which mimic conventional roofing and can improve aesthetic charm. Do not fail to remember to analyze the design and placement of the panels to take full advantage of both efficiency and aesthetic harmony.

Eventually, striking the appropriate equilibrium in between performance and appearances will certainly make your solar financial investment extra fulfilling.
